About the course

Environmental conditions on our planet are rapidly approaching a critical state and we are facing issues including global climate change, deoxygenation and acidification of our oceans, pollution in various environments, and environmental degradation.What is environmental geoscience?Environmental geoscience provides a holistic understanding of factors influencing environmental conditions on Earth. Environmental geoscientists play a vital role when assessing environmental challenges from local to global scales. This expertise is crucial within the framework of a sustainable environment. You will explore the conditions of Earth's past so you can protect its future, evaluate the risks related to critical environmental issues of global importance, and use your expertise to inform discussions on addressing acute environmental challenges. What will I learn?This degree prepares you for a wide range of careers within environmental geosciences and beyond. It carefully balances data science, programming, and computing skills with traditional field and laboratory skills, along with understanding the functioning of the Earth's environment.You will study a comprehensive range of topics related to the environment, and factors shaping environmental conditions on Earth. We will address physical, chemical and biological processes that control the world's oceans, atmosphere and ecosystems paying particular attention to processes that connect the various environmental settings.You will develop crucial skills needed to address important challenges, including:

  • how we predict and mitigate the effects of global climate change
  • what tools we can use to reduce greenhouse gas emissions
  • why our planet can sustain life
  • how we can reduce the effects of environmental pollution
  • whether changes in seawater properties will affect the ocean's role as a food source
  • how the increased CO2 concentration in seawaters affect life in the ocean
Many of your activities will simulate those that professionals perform in the real world. You will also learn sought-after computational analysis and quantitative skills that are in demand across a range of employment sectors, such as:
  • acquiring, analysing, assessing and presenting a wide range of data
  • computing skills including programming and use of specialist software
  • computer modelling
  • Geographical Information Systems (GIS).
  • using a range of specialist laboratory techniques
  • applying observational and sample collection techniques in the field
